Overview of the Products

The 4.8 AMP Corded Variable Speed Orbital JIG Saw is priced at $54.79, while the CAMXTOOL Cordless Jig Saw with Battery & Charger is available for $59.99. The price difference of about 8% makes the Ryobi model the more budget-friendly option of the two. However, the CAMXTOOL jigsaw offers the advantage of portability with its cordless design, appealing to users who need flexibility in their projects.

Power and Performance Comparison

The Ryobi jigsaw boasts a robust 4.8 AMP motor, delivering reliable power for various cutting tasks. This power translates into consistent performance, making it suitable for demanding jobs. In contrast, the CAMXTOOL operates on a battery system, providing a maximum output of 750W and a rapid speed of 2800 RPM, which enhances its cutting capabilities in a cordless format. While both tools are effective, the choice between them may depend on whether you prioritize corded power or the convenience of cordless operation.

Cutting Capabilities

The cutting capabilities of the two jigsaws differ significantly. The Ryobi jigsaw is designed for general-purpose cutting, suitable for wood and other materials, but does not highlight advanced features in this area. In contrast, the CAMXTOOL offers a ±45° bevel cutting feature, enabling users to make precise cuts at various angles. Additionally, it has a 3-gear orbital setting, optimizing performance for different materials like wood, PVC, and metal. This versatility makes the CAMXTOOL a superior choice for those who need to tackle a variety of cutting tasks.

Portability and Convenience

Portability is a significant factor to consider when choosing between these jigsaws. The Ryobi model, being corded, limits mobility and can be cumbersome in spaces without nearby outlets. In contrast, the CAMXTOOL’s cordless design allows for easy transport and use in locations far from power sources, making it ideal for outdoor projects or remote job sites. The included battery and charger enhance this convenience, providing everything you need to get started right away.
